A VF used example of the 10/- ultramarine King George VI from the 1949 Overprinted King George VI Issue with genuine Tangier cancel. This stamp has a genuine Tangier cancel, as evidenced by the inclusion of the word Tangier in the cancel indicta, though it is not completely clear. The stamps of Morocco Agencies, except for the French and Spanish Currencies were valid for use in the UK after 1950, and quite frequently the used stamps found on the market are with UK cancels, rather than Morocco ones. Because of this, Scott values for used are wildly different from Gibbons values, because Gibbons prices genuine Morocco cancels, whereas Scott does not.
